Welding bays: Weldability-Sif

Welding bays can be designed and installed by UK firm Weldability-Sif using a modular walling system, according to the company.

The firm comments that welding bays are constructed using floor-mounted acoustic panels that are manufactured for epoxy coated steel with a sound absorbing core; panels are secure to the workshop floor via adjustable brackets which allow for uneven surfaces.

Weldability-Sif adds that panels can be manufactured in varying configurations making them adaptable for nearly all working areas. A bronze impact-resistant viewing panel can be incorporated into panels to allow supervision from outside of a welding bay and also to avoid people entering the bay when hazardous operations are taking place, say the company.

They go on to explain that access to welding bays can be provided using a standard welding strip curtaining and as an option these can be mounted on a sliding rail to provide unobstructed entry and exit when manoeuvring items in and out of the working area.

Provision can also be made for a robust mounting point for power, gas and air supply points to be secured at a convenient location, and if a fume control system is to be used a mounting rail module can be added to the top of the panels to allow mounting of a fume arm and bracket, say the firm.
